Tips for Effective Pest Control

  • Seal Entry Points: Seal cracks and crevices in walls, foundations, and around windows and doors to prevent pests from entering your property. This simple step can significantly reduce the risk of infestations. Inspect your property regularly for potential entry points and seal them promptly.
  • Eliminate Standing Water: Standing water provides breeding grounds for mosquitoes and other pests. Remove any sources of standing water, such as clogged gutters, birdbaths, and flower pots, to discourage pest proliferation. Regularly check your property for areas where water accumulates.
  • Proper Waste Management: Store garbage in tightly sealed containers and dispose of it regularly to prevent attracting pests. Maintain cleanliness around garbage disposal areas to minimize the risk of infestations. Proper waste management is essential for community-wide pest control.
  • Landscaping Maintenance: Trim vegetation around your property to reduce pest harborage areas. Keep grass mowed short and remove debris and leaf litter to discourage pests from nesting near your building. Regular landscaping maintenance contributes to a pest-free environment.
  • Store Food Properly: Store food in airtight containers to prevent attracting pests. Clean up spills and crumbs promptly to eliminate food sources for insects and rodents. Proper food storage is crucial for preventing infestations in kitchens and pantries.

Frequently Asked Questions

John: What are the most common pests in Riviera Beach?

Professional: Common pests in Riviera Beach include mosquitoes, cockroaches, termites, ants, rodents, and occasional seasonal infestations of sand fleas. The specific pests present can vary depending on the location and surrounding environment.

Sarah: How often should I have my property inspected for pests?

Professional: It’s generally recommended to have your property inspected for pests at least annually. However, in areas with high pest pressure, like coastal regions, more frequent inspections, such as quarterly or bi-annually, may be beneficial for early detection and prevention.
